Understanding Negligent Security Claims

Negligent security claims assess whether a property owner failed to provide reasonable safety measures, such as lighting, surveillance, and security personnel, that could have prevented harm.

In California and in Chino, liability often depends on the duty of care owed to visitors and the link between security gaps and injuries. We review cameras, incident reports, and witness statements to determine who is responsible.

Definition and Explanation

A negligent security claim is filed when a property owner’s failure to maintain a safe environment contributes to an injury. This may involve inadequate lighting, broken locks, insufficient security staff, or lax surveillance that a reasonable owner should address.

Key Elements and Processes

To prevail, we establish duty, breach, causation, and damages, followed by evidence collection, demand letters, negotiations with insurers, and, if necessary, a civil claim in California courts.

Key Terms and Glossary

Glossary terms help clarify common phrases used in negligent security discussions, from premises liability to standards of care in California law.

Premises Liability

Legal responsibility for injuries caused by an unsafe condition on someone else’s property, including security defects.

Security Standards

Standards or practices that a property owner should reasonably implement to maintain a secure environment for guests and tenants.

Duty of Care

The obligation to act with reasonable care to prevent harm to visitors, which may include maintaining lighting, locks, cameras, and staff.

Notice of Risk

Knowledge of potential security hazards that the owner could have addressed, which strengthens a claim if not remediated.

Common Circumstances Requiring This Service

Incidents on commercial properties, apartment buildings, hotels, or public venues with weak lighting, poor access control, or insufficient security can justify pursuing a negligent security claim.

Inadequate Lighting

Dim lighting or poorly lit walkways can contribute to slips, trips, or assault injuries.

Lack of Surveillance

Absent or malfunctioning cameras make it harder to reconstruct events and hold owners accountable.

Insufficient Security Personnel

Inadequate security staffing can leave visitors exposed to risks and delay response times.
